Joico Purple Shampoo has become a popular choice among individuals looking to maintain and enhance their blonde or silver hair tones. This shampoo is specifically formulated to eliminate brassiness and yellow tones, resulting in stunning, vibrant hair. However, to achieve the best results, it’s essential to use Joico Purple Shampoo properly. In this article, we will provide you with a step-by-step guide on how to utilize this product effectively and also address common queries through 20 lists of questions and answers.

Step 1: Wet your hair thoroughly. Ensure that your hair is completely soaked before applying any shampoo.

Step 2: Squeeze a small amount of Joico Purple Shampoo into your hand. You only need a small quantity, as a little goes a long way.

Step 3: Apply the shampoo evenly throughout your hair. Massage it gently into your scalp and work it through the lengths of your hair.

Step 4: Leave the shampoo on for 2-3 minutes. This allows the purple pigments to neutralize the unwanted yellow or brassy hues effectively.

Step 5: Rinse your hair thoroughly. Make sure all traces of the shampoo are washed out before proceeding to the next steps of your hair care routine.

Step 6: For optimal results, follow up with a nourishing conditioner. Joico offers a variety of conditioners specifically designed to complement their purple shampoo. Select one that suits your hair type and apply it from mid-length to ends. Leave it on for a few minutes and rinse thoroughly.

Step 7: Style your hair as desired. You will notice a visible difference in the vibrancy and shine of your blonde or silver tones.

1. How often should I use Joico Purple Shampoo?
– Using it once or twice a week is generally recommended. However, this may vary depending on your hair type and the intensity of brassiness you want to counteract.

2. Can I leave the shampoo on for longer than 3 minutes?
– It is not advisable to exceed the recommended time, as it may result in an over-toned, purplish hue. Stick to the suggested duration for optimal results.

3. Will Joico Purple Shampoo work on brown hair with highlights?
– This shampoo is primarily formulated to address brassy or yellow tones in blonde or silver hair. While it may provide some toning effects on highlights, it is not specifically designed for brown hair.

4. Should I use a clarifying shampoo before Joico Purple Shampoo?
– It’s not necessary but recommended. A clarifying shampoo can help remove any product build-up or excess oil, allowing the purple shampoo to work more effectively.

10. Can I use Joico Purple Shampoo on natural grey hair?
– Absolutely! This shampoo can help neutralize any yellowing or dullness in natural grey hair, providing a more youthful and vibrant appearance.

11. Is Joico Purple Shampoo safe for daily use?
– It is generally safe, but using it daily may lead to over-toning or a purplish tint. Therefore, it is recommended to incorporate it into your hair care routine once or twice a week.

12. Can Joico Purple Shampoo replace my regular shampoo?
– While it is designed for toning purposes, it is not a substitute for a regular shampoo. It is best used in conjunction with your regular shampoo to maintain clean and healthy hair.

13. Will Joico Purple Shampoo stain my hands?
– The purple pigments in the shampoo can temporarily tint your hands during application. However, it should wash off easily with soap and water.
